Random Facts About Birds For Kids

Hummingbirds visit up to 2,000 flowers per day when feeding!

A full-grown chicken drinks about 500 milliliters of water each day — that’s about two cups!

Baby macaws learn to talk by listening to their parents, just like human babies learn language from their families!

Frigatebirds have very small feet compared to their body size, which makes them poor walkers but excellent flyers!

Finches, like zebra finches, can learn to recognize different human voices and respond to their names!
